Meaning of Monarch
A sovereign head of state, especially a king, queen, or emperor.
In simple words: A king or queen who rules a country.

Common mistakes with Monarch
- Confused with 'monarchy', which refers to the system of rule.
- Often used inaccurately to describe leaders in non-royal positions.
